A girl I work with is attempting a VBAC in a month or two and mentioned she thought about using her breast pump to see if that would induce her labor as most OB's don't induce for vbac's nor let you go late... Thought on the idea of pumping starting around 38 weeks?

Re: Labor question

  • I wouldn't do it. I'd resort to less invasive means of bring on labor like walking, sex, and all the others that I'm forgetting at this point. VBAC or not, I wouldn't try to bring on labor by pumping.

  • I tried the pump at close to 40 weeks last time. It did give me BH, but I also was getting a lot of colostrum out and it was freaking me out, so I stopped. I was worried that I would waste the good stuff or something!

    Anyhow, you can have DH "play" around with them, and that often helps. I also won't be trying anything until really like, 39+ weeks. 

    And yes, my doctor will not induce me for a VBAC either, as it's not really safe to use pit.

  • Your Dr. should be able to induce you with a Foley Bulb. You just cannot use prostaglandins to induce. I might try the pump, but I would want to do a ton more research first. So I don't have an educated opinion on the topic.
